Color Name: Weldon Blue

What is hex #7E9A9A Color?

Weldon Blue (Hex code: 7E9A9A) Thumbnail

The color name of hex code #7E9A9A is Weldon Blue. The RGB values are (126, 154, 154) which means it is composed of 29% red, 35% green and 35% blue. The CMYK color codes, used in printers, are C:18 M:0 Y:0 K:40. In the HSV/HSB scale, #7E9A9A has a hue of 180°, 18% saturation and a brightness value of 60%.

Complementary Palette

The complement of #7E9A9A is #9A7E7E which is called Cinereous. Complementary colors are those found at the opposite ends of the color wheel. Thus, as per the RGB system, the best contrast to #7E9A9A color is offered by #9A7E7E. The complementary color palette is easiest to use and work with. Studies have shown that contrasting color palette is the best way to grab a viewer's attention.

Split-Complementary Palette

As per the RGB color wheel, the split-complementary colors of #7E9A9A are #9A7E8C (Mountbatten Pink) and #9A8C7E (Cinereous). A split-complementary color palette consists of the main color along with those on either side (30°) of the complementary color. Based on our research, usage of split-complementary palettes is on the rise online, especially in graphics and web sites designs. It may be because it is not as contrasting as the complementary color palette and, hence, results in a combination which is pleasant to the eyes.

Triadic Palette

#7E9A9A triadic color palette has three colors each of which is separated by 120° in the RGB wheel. Thus, #9A7E9A (Mountbatten Pink) and #9A9A7E (Artichoke) along with #7E9A9A, our main color, create a stunning and beautiful triadic palette with the maximum variation in hue and, therefore, offering the best possible contrast when taken together.

Square Palette

The square color palette of #7E9A9A contains #8C7E9A (Roman Silver), #9A7E7E (Cinereous) and #8C9A7E (Artichoke). Quite like triadic, the hues in a square palette are at the maximum distance from each other, which is 90°.
Note: For several colors purposes, a square palette may look much better than the tetrad color palette.
